def rename_face(self, old_name: str, new_name: str) -> None:
valid_name_pattern = r"^[a-zA-Z0-9_-]{1,50}$"
try:
sanitized_old_name = sanitize_filename(old_name, replacement_text="_")
sanitized_new_name = sanitize_filename(new_name, replacement_text="_")
except ValidationError as e:
raise ValueError(f"Invalid face name: {str(e)}")
if not re.match(valid_name_pattern, old_name):
raise ValueError(f"Invalid old face name: {old_name}")
if not re.match(valid_name_pattern, new_name):
raise ValueError(f"Invalid new face name: {new_name}")
if sanitized_old_name != old_name:
raise ValueError(f"Old face name contains invalid characters: {old_name}")
if sanitized_new_name != new_name:
raise ValueError(f"New face name contains invalid characters: {new_name}")
old_path = os.path.normpath(os.path.join(FACE_DIR, old_name))
new_path = os.path.normpath(os.path.join(FACE_DIR, new_name))
# Prevent path traversal
if not old_path.startswith(
os.path.normpath(FACE_DIR)
) or not new_path.startswith(os.path.normpath(FACE_DIR)):
raise ValueError("Invalid path detected")
if not os.path.exists(old_path):
raise ValueError(f"Face {old_name} not found.")
os.rename(old_path, new_path)
self.requestor.send_data(
EmbeddingsRequestEnum.clear_face_classifier.value, None
)
